Norra Lidtjärnen
Character of the water
Norra Lidtjärnen lies in central Sweden — a mesotrophic lake.
The surroundings
The lake sits close to town with a road right up to it — easy to reach, but hard-fished and exposed to nutrient runoff from the buildings and fields all around.
Shallow throughout (max 2 m), with reeds and vegetation over large areas — water that warms fast in spring.
Permits & rules
Fishing permit required — Norra Lidtjärnen FVOF. Day permit ~60 kr · annual permit ~300 kr.
- Zander: minimum size 45 cm · protected during the spawn (Apr–May).
- Pike: keep at most one over 75 cm per day.
- Handheld tackle only. Respect the protected zones at the inlets and outlets.

Fishing Norra Lidtjärnen
perch, pike and zander sit at the top of the food chain in Norra Lidtjärnen, carried by roach and ruffe. The clearer water makes the fish wary — and rewards a careful presentation.
